NSAIDs are amongst the most commonly utilized non-prescription pain relievers. They work by lowering inflammation, which is frequently a source of pain. Common NSAIDs include:
Drug NameBrand NameCommon UsesDosage and FrequencyPossible Side EffectsIbuprofenAdvil, MotrinHeadaches, muscle pain, arthritis200-400 mg every 6-8 hoursIndigestion, bleeding, kidney problemsNaproxenAleveNeck and back pain, menstrual pain, headaches220 mg every 8-12 hoursStomach ulcers, increased bleeding dangerAspirinBayer, BufferinGeneral pain relief, inflammation325-650 mg every 4-6 hoursStomach irritation, Reye's syndrome in kidsAcetaminophen

Topical analgesics are used straight to the skin and normally include components that supply pain relief through a numbing result or by increasing blood circulation.
Drug NameBrand NameTypical UsesDose and FrequencyPossible Side EffectsLidocaineAspercreme, LidodermMuscle and joint pain, nerve painApply 3-4 times a daySkin inflammationCapsaicinCapzasin, ZostrixNerve pain, osteoarthritisApply 3-4 times dailyBurning experience at application websiteMentholBen-Gay, IcyHotMuscle pains, minor arthritis painApply 3-4 times a daySkin inflammation, allergic reactionsAntihistamines

When picking a buy non-prescription pain relief drugs pain relief medication, consider these aspects:
Type of Pain: Understand the kind of pain you are experiencing (e.g., muscle pain, headache, arthritis) to select the proper medication.
Case history: Consult a healthcare provider if you have a history of liver disease, kidney issues, gastrointestinal concerns, or allergic reactions.
Drug Interactions: Be mindful of other medications you are taking, as some OTC drugs can communicate negatively with prescription medications.
Dosage: Always follow dose guidelines on the product packaging. Overuse can result in severe side effects.
Specific Populations: Pregnant ladies, children, and the elderly may require unique factors to consider when selecting pain relief choices.
